Output 2591f00183d03f687b4e52f2efec59b8ea2ed5e939c44e0ef5c97433b4176f45:0

value
258533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a652e326beef0b74683b782a2e4d35bcd34adcf5 OP_EQUAL
address
MP4bhPJPvV17YXh8ZNUzV2Ty1362wJMiXj
transaction
2591f00183d03f687b4e52f2efec59b8ea2ed5e939c44e0ef5c97433b4176f45
spent
true